What is the role of nebulae in the formation of planets?
-
They provide the necessary material for planet formation
-
They trigger the collapse of protoplanetary disks
-
They regulate the temperature of protoplanetary disks
-
They prevent the formation of planets
A
Correct answer
Explanation
Nebulae play a role in the formation of planets by providing the necessary material for the process. The gas and dust in nebulae can collapse under its own gravity, forming protoplanetary disks, which are the precursors to planetary systems.

What was the primary purpose of comet observations in ancient Indian astronomy?
-
Predicting the weather
-
Understanding celestial mechanics
-
Determining the time of religious festivals
-
Foretelling future events
D
Correct answer
Explanation
In ancient Indian astronomy, comet observations were primarily used for foretelling future events, such as political changes, natural disasters, and the rise and fall of empires.
